Output e2a761966e8b8b94131dc8a442815aefe562f21c19cb552a4d4166c0521fc581:1

value
367368617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d29ce6bb5fa9d678012ea8c0f1c9d14990cc5a OP_EQUAL
address
3FiMcXwnskBHiXzSRd7vCt3ydyf4xaQyzP
transaction
e2a761966e8b8b94131dc8a442815aefe562f21c19cb552a4d4166c0521fc581
spent
true